BASHCMA Commences Development of 2026 Operational Plan to Align with State Budget

By Abubakar Musa Waziri

The Bauchi State Health Contributory Management Agency (BASHCMA) has initiated the development of its 2026 Annual Operational Plan (AOP) to ensure alignment with the state’s upcoming fiscal framework.

The planning meeting, which runs from August 29th to 31st, 2025, includes participants from all agency directorates. In his opening address, Executive Secretary Alhaji Ibrahim Inuwa Duguri (Yariman Yankari) urged attendees to develop a realistic, actionable, and inclusive roadmap. He cautioned against including unrealistic activities or inflated costs, which could impact the agency’s performance ratings.

The meeting also emphasized aligning the AOP with the National Health Sector Strategic Blueprint (2023–2027) and the new Federal Government Sector-Wide Approach (SWAp) initiative, as highlighted by State Deputy Desk Officer Pharmacist Ibrahim Muhammad.

The Director of Planning, Research and Statistics, Hajiya Rahmatu Haruna Musa, stated the goal is to collaboratively design a plan that supports BASHCMA’s strategic goals and Bauchi State’s health priorities. A goodwill message was delivered by Mr. Jinjiri John Garba, representing civil society organizations.
